You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

Git自动补全表现奇怪

如果Git自动补全表现奇怪,可能是由于以下原因之一:

  1. 安装了不兼容的shell插件:某些shell插件可能与Git的自动补全功能不兼容,导致奇怪的行为。解决方法是禁用或移除不兼容的插件,或尝试使用其他插件。

  2. 自动补全脚本被损坏:Git的自动补全功能依赖于一个自动补全脚本。如果该脚本被损坏或修改,可能会导致奇怪的表现。解决方法是重新安装Git或修复脚本。

以下是一个示例解决方法:

步骤1:禁用或移除不兼容的shell插件(如果有)

检查是否安装了与Git自动补全功能不兼容的shell插件。常见的插件如Oh-My-Zsh或Oh-My-Bash。如果发现这类插件,可以尝试禁用它们或移除它们,然后重新启动终端。

步骤2:重新安装Git

如果禁用或移除插件没有解决问题,可以考虑重新安装Git。这将重置Git的配置和自动补全脚本,可能解决奇怪的表现。具体步骤如下(以Ubuntu为例):

  1. 打开终端。
  2. 运行以下命令卸载Git:
sudo apt-get remove git
  1. 运行以下命令重新安装Git:
sudo apt-get install git
  1. 重新启动终端。

步骤3:修复自动补全脚本

如果重新安装Git仍然没有解决问题,可以尝试修复自动补全脚本。自动补全脚本通常位于Git的安装目录下的contrib/completion文件夹中。

  1. 打开终端。
  2. 运行以下命令找到自动补全脚本的位置:
which git
  1. 使用文本编辑器打开自动补全脚本文件。例如,如果自动补全脚本位于/usr/share/git/completion/git-completion.bash,可以运行以下命令打开它:
sudo nano /usr/share/git/completion/git-completion.bash
  1. 检查脚本是否被修改或损坏。如果是,可以尝试将脚本恢复到默认状态,或者从Git的官方仓库中获取一个新的脚本。

  2. 保存并关闭文件。

重新启动终端后,应该能够看到Git的自动补全功能恢复正常。如果问题仍然存在,可以尝试在Git的官方文档或论坛中寻找更多解决方法。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

GitHub Copilot:让开发编程变得像说话一样简单 |社区征文

开发者工程师们的得力助手[GitHub Copilot](https://mp.weixin.qq.com/s?__biz=Mzg3MTIyNDA3Mg==&mid=2247498862&idx=1&sn=15e318b64d8fc2f3c8b9dafa9ae7b1ac&chksm=ce837a09f9f4f31fdbac7b4a99e82569f9131e587ccc... 由此可见,AI可以协助我们开发者完成自动补全代码块、单方法以及函数,并根据代码注释提示自动生成可运行的代码片段。在使用 Microsoft Visual Studio、Vim、Visual Studio Code、JetBrains 集成开发环境,通过 Cop...

2022 vim实践总结 |社区征文

并写了一套自动换配置脚本:```https://github.com/IceLeeGit/VimPlus.git```需求与解决方案:> 为了方便快速搭建适合自己的vim编译环境,就需要解决由于网络问题而不能下载对应github库的问题,以及自动执行配... > - 支持代码补全> - 支持C以及C++代码跳转功能> - 支持python代码跳转功能> - 支持快捷键提示功能> - 支持标签页面快速切换> - 支持状态栏> - 支持路径补全功能> - 支持批量编辑、批量删除...

集简云6月更新合集:新增40款集成应用,更新14款应用,新增200多个可用动作

人力发展等链服务。 官网:https://sh.woqu365.com/ **可用执行动作** * 批量新增或修改成员* 创建岗位* 卡* 导入打卡数据 **应用使用示例****表单系统+喔趣:**当表单系统有新增人员列表时,自动将人员在喔趣批量新增 02 **外卖邦** ![picture.image](https://p6-volc-community-sign.byt...

2022 年每个开发者必知的云原生趋势 | 社区征文

自动化的开发流程来实现。这些是从字面上对Cloud Native的解构,然后我们再来看看[云原生计算基金会](https://www.cncf.io/)(Cloud Native Computing Foundation, CNCF)提供的[官方定义](https://github.com/cncf... 所有这些工作都通过自动化完成。由两台以上的服务器组成的阵列,一般使用自动化工具构建,阵列中没有哪个服务器是不可替代的。通常情况下,故障事件不需要人工干预,因为阵列表现出 "绕过故障"的属性,通过重新启动故...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

Git自动补全表现奇怪-优选内容

GitHub Copilot:让开发编程变得像说话一样简单 |社区征文
开发者工程师们的得力助手[GitHub Copilot](https://mp.weixin.qq.com/s?__biz=Mzg3MTIyNDA3Mg==&mid=2247498862&idx=1&sn=15e318b64d8fc2f3c8b9dafa9ae7b1ac&chksm=ce837a09f9f4f31fdbac7b4a99e82569f9131e587ccc... 由此可见,AI可以协助我们开发者完成自动补全代码块、单方法以及函数,并根据代码注释提示自动生成可运行的代码片段。在使用 Microsoft Visual Studio、Vim、Visual Studio Code、JetBrains 集成开发环境,通过 Cop...
2022 vim实践总结 |社区征文
并写了一套自动换配置脚本:```https://github.com/IceLeeGit/VimPlus.git```需求与解决方案:> 为了方便快速搭建适合自己的vim编译环境,就需要解决由于网络问题而不能下载对应github库的问题,以及自动执行配... > - 支持代码补全> - 支持C以及C++代码跳转功能> - 支持python代码跳转功能> - 支持快捷键提示功能> - 支持标签页面快速切换> - 支持状态栏> - 支持路径补全功能> - 支持批量编辑、批量删除...
集简云6月更新合集:新增40款集成应用,更新14款应用,新增200多个可用动作
人力发展等链服务。 官网:https://sh.woqu365.com/ **可用执行动作** * 批量新增或修改成员* 创建岗位* 卡* 导入打卡数据 **应用使用示例****表单系统+喔趣:**当表单系统有新增人员列表时,自动将人员在喔趣批量新增 02 **外卖邦** ![picture.image](https://p6-volc-community-sign.byt...
2022 年每个开发者必知的云原生趋势 | 社区征文
自动化的开发流程来实现。这些是从字面上对Cloud Native的解构,然后我们再来看看[云原生计算基金会](https://www.cncf.io/)(Cloud Native Computing Foundation, CNCF)提供的[官方定义](https://github.com/cncf... 所有这些工作都通过自动化完成。由两台以上的服务器组成的阵列,一般使用自动化工具构建,阵列中没有哪个服务器是不可替代的。通常情况下,故障事件不需要人工干预,因为阵列表现出 "绕过故障"的属性,通过重新启动故...

Git自动补全表现奇怪-相关内容

Bazel 构建加速快速入门

自动生成域名。 remote-executor 展示远端构建执行的域名。系统将根据您填写的实例名称(本示例为 bazel01)和地域信息,自动生成域名。 构建镜像 选择远端构建集群使用的容器镜像。本示例使用预置镜像。 计费类型 当... shell git clone https://github.com/abseil/abseil-cpp.git开启分布式编译。请补全命令中 remote_executor 和 remote_cache 缺失的 cluster_name 和 region。 shell cd abseil-cpp 正常情况下执行下面的编译命令...

ClickHouse 在字节跳动广告 DMP& CDP 的应用

=&rk3s=8031ce6d&x-expires=1714580447&x-signature=a%2BgitznLGULlDR2%2F8j%2FkRrNCKug%3D)首先是并行计算,相比于之前用子查询来表示交集和集,采用 RoaringBitmap 来实现交集和补集要简单很多,这样使得我们的计算可以更加充分的并行,到线程粒度。这样,一方面我们可以更好的利用上多核的计算资源。另一方面,可以更好的控制查询使用的资源,避免一些大查询占用过多资源。如上图所示,我们把量数据分成很多份,每台机器的...

蚂蚁集团混沌工程 ChaosMeta V0.5 版本发布

后续会逐步补充 RPC、DB client、redis client 等其他类型的流量注入能力。底层实现是基于开源组件 jmeter 实现的,每个流量注入任务启动一个 jmeter 的 job 执行。![picture.image](https://p6-volc-community-s... 目前很难完依赖机器去自动设计。但是我们可以把其中的可复用经验系统化抽象出来,整理成册,在对同一类组件进行混沌工程演练的时候,就可以快速复用起来,这个就是风险目录的设计初衷。风险目录前期主要是以理论的...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

火山引擎 LAS 数据湖存储内核揭秘

根据 SQL 的特点自动路由到 Spark,Presto 或 Flink 中去执行。再往下一层是统一元数据层,第四层是流批一体存储层。![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/dc6e5ca74... gItTTiHVZLImQbznvI%3D)LAS 流批一体存储是基于开源的 Apache Hudi 构建的,在整个落地过程中,我们遇到了一些**问题**。Apache Hudi 仅支持单表的元数据管理,缺乏统一的局视图,会存在数据孤岛。Hudi 选择通过同步...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询